This is the Lumo, this has been by Eva skin, this has been my all-time radio frequency device that I love. This is using heat, so when you're talking about radio frequency, you're heating the dermis to a point of between 40 and 43 degrees Celsius. If it's FDA cleared, it's going to be in that sweet spot. If it's saying that it is a radio frequency device and that it's for skin tightening, it's generally in that sweet spot of 40 to 43 degrees C.

When you're on semaglutide, which is the active ingredient in those weight loss shots, it's a GLP-1 agonist, right, so it makes you feel full. It slows down the pace at which your food travels through your digestive tract. Now if we just all put on our thinking caps for a second and thought about metabolism, there should be some bells going off that when you get off of this, that has slowed down your metabolism because it slowed down the way food moves through your body. You're going to have a rebound effect.

"The strongest laser for skin resurfacing is the CO2, that hasn't changed in a long time, that's the gold standard for skin resurfacing. CO2 lasers target both the superficial so right on the surface but also super deep layers of the skin. It removes damaged skin cells and pigmentation, literally it just burns them all off. The recovery time can be longer than other lasers because it is ablative. It stimulates the skin to produce new collagen and skin structures. It's used for deep wrinkles, severe sun damage, significant scarring, sagging skin, and removing precancerous cells."

"BPC-157 helps to balance the dopaminergic, serotonergic, and GABAergic systems of the brain, so it helps and has a balancing effect on neurotransmitters. However, there is a small portion of people that can have quite severe reactions to BPC-157 in terms of anxiety and all kinds of weird symptoms like neurological symptoms. For that reason, you have to be cautious and very mindful when you're introducing something like that into your body. You really have to tap into yourself and how you're feeling because if you wake up the next morning with severe anxiety that you didn't have the day before, you have to be open to the possibility that it is this new thing that you've introduced into your body. What I've seen is the faster you stop, the better off you are. Gritting your teeth and musing your way through and just continuing to use it is a bad idea. There are enough people I've heard of now who've had an issue that I think it's worth mentioning so that people understand that it can happen."
"Radiesse is made out of calcium hydroxylapatite and basically what this is, it's a cream based filler that is going to stimulate collagen. It's going to be the gift that keeps on giving because once the filler starts going down the collagen is going to start building up over the next 6 weeks and this stuff stays around for about 2 years. This is not your typical filler, this is a biomodulator. The difference between a hyaluronic acid filler is that it's a gel form that hydrates, and it stays in there for what 3 to 4 months depending on which one it could be from a year to 3 years. Radiasse is very different in that this is a biomodulator that is cream based and is not dissolvable."

"The NuFace Mini stimulates muscle contractions and improves facial tone, and it's lymphatically draining so that will also help look a little bit more chiseled and it helps with wound healing. That's where I think I'm getting the most benefit from it. I still have this, I still use it, it's not my favorite though. When you look at how the face ages anatomically, muscle tone is not one of the top ways that a face ages because we're constantly moving our face. Your muscle tone in your face is not one of the top three ways that our face ages. It's that redistribution of fat. When we age we lose fat volume under the eyes, here on the temples, on the cheeks. It's this lack of fat that happens that then the anatomy sags, and we've got the jowly area right. So it's that loss of fat that is the most common."

"This is salmon sperm. This is a multi-peptide by Medicube. It's PDRN Pink Peptide Serum. So it's got multiple peptides in it, but it also has nucleotides derived from salmon sperm. The nucleotides in salmon sperm very closely match the nucleotides found in our skin. When we have genetic gaps, we're missing something, that's a sign of aging. When your genes aren't replicating exactly how they're supposed to, that's a sign of aging. What this does is it fills in those genetic gaps. So it helps a lot with DNA repair. There's lots of different versions, but right now, this is my favorite."

"This is Differin Adapalene Gel. It's a third generation retinoid, so it's great for sensitive skin. There's a lot of research that this is very comparable to like a 0.05% without the irritation. I have a lot of clients that I put on this. It's my base. After I microneedle, when I start adding the retinoid back in, which is usually day two or three depending on how quick I'm healing, I'll go back to this before I would go back to a bigger one. I go back to this, let my skin stabilize a little bit, and then I go back to the retinoid that I'm using every night."

"I'm just a 55-year-old gerontologist and healthy aging specialist, but in my personal opinion in terms of the health of your skin, if you could only buy one device I would buy a red light therapy device. They make different masks, and you guys have heard me talk a lot about the Omnilux mask because it is in my opinion the best one on the market right now. What red light therapy does is a certain wavelength ends up going through the epidermis of the skin. When you're looking at a red light therapy device, what you really want to look for is a wavelength of 630 to 680 NM of red light. A red light therapy device like this has a combination of red and near infrared, so if you have melasma, you want to make sure that you're turning off the near infrared on this because near infrared could actually make melasma worse."
